开源AI智能体平台NemoClaw:企业级自主智能体的部署与安全实践
2026.04.14 17:17浏览量:0简介:本文深入解析开源AI智能体平台NemoClaw的核心架构、部署流程与安全机制,帮助企业开发者快速掌握从安装到生产环境落地的全流程,重点探讨其策略引擎、数据隔离与跨硬件兼容性等关键技术特性。
一、平台定位与技术演进背景
在2026年全球开发者生态中,AI智能体已从概念验证阶段迈向规模化企业应用。某头部科技企业在年度开发者大会上发布的NemoClaw平台,正是这一技术趋势的典型代表。该平台通过将强化学习框架、自动化决策引擎与安全沙箱技术深度整合,构建出支持企业级自主智能体开发的基础设施。
相较于传统RPA(机器人流程自动化)工具,NemoClaw实现了三大突破:
- 动态环境适应:智能体可基于实时数据调整执行策略,而非依赖预设脚本
- 跨系统协同:通过统一接口层兼容不同业务系统的API规范
- 隐私安全闭环:内置数据脱敏与访问控制机制,满足金融、医疗等强监管行业要求
技术架构上,平台采用分层设计模式:
┌───────────────┐ ┌───────────────┐ ┌───────────────┐│ 智能体编排层 │ ←→ │ 策略引擎层 │ ←→ │ 硬件抽象层 │└───────────────┘ └───────────────┘ └───────────────┘↑ ↑ ↑┌───────────────────────────────────────────────────────┐│ 安全管控中台(策略/审计/加密) │└───────────────────────────────────────────────────────┘
二、极简部署与跨架构兼容实现
1. 标准化安装流程
平台通过容器化技术将核心组件封装为轻量级镜像,开发者仅需执行两行命令即可完成基础环境搭建:
# 拉取基础镜像(约1.2GB)docker pull nemoclaw/base:2026.03# 启动编排服务(自动初始化策略引擎)docker run -d --name nemoclaw-orchestrator \-p 8080:8080 \-v /data/policies:/etc/nemoclaw/policies \nemoclaw/base:2026.03
初始化过程中,系统会自动检测宿主机的硬件配置,动态加载适配的加速库(如针对GPU的cuDNN优化模块或针对ARM架构的NEON指令集支持)。
2. 异构硬件支持机制
为解决企业环境中常见的硬件碎片化问题,平台采用三级适配方案:
- 指令集级兼容:通过LLVM编译器后端生成目标架构的优化代码
- 驱动抽象层:统一封装不同厂商的AI加速卡驱动接口
- 资源调度器:基于Kubernetes扩展实现跨节点资源池化
实测数据显示,在包含x86、ARM和RISC-V混合架构的测试集群中,智能体任务调度延迟控制在15ms以内,资源利用率提升40%。
三、安全防护体系深度解析
1. 三层数据防护架构
网络护栏(Network Fence)
通过eBPF技术实现零信任网络访问控制,每个智能体实例获得独立虚拟网络接口,默认拒绝所有入站连接。流量转发规则采用属性基访问控制(ABAC)模型:
{"policy_id": "nw-policy-001","subject": {"agent_id": "finance-reconcile-v2","security_level": "high"},"resource": {"service": "payment-gateway","endpoint": "/api/v1/transactions"},"action": "POST","conditions": {"time_window": ["09:00", "18:00"],"data_sensitivity": ["PCI-DSS", "PII"]}}
隐私路由器(Privacy Router)
在数据流转路径中插入动态脱敏节点,支持正则表达式、FPE格式保留加密等多种脱敏算法。例如处理身份证号时:
def desensitize_id(raw_id):if len(raw_id) == 18:return raw_id[:6] + "********" + raw_id[-4:]return raw_id # 非18位不处理
策略引擎(Policy Engine)
采用OPA(Open Policy Agent)实现细粒度权限控制,支持将业务规则转化为Rego语言策略:
package nemoclaw.authzdefault allow = falseallow {input.action == "read"input.resource.type == "customer_data"input.subject.attributes.department == "risk_management"time_of_day_check(input.time)}time_of_day_check(time) {hour := time.hourhour >= 9hour <= 18}
2. 运行时安全机制
- 行为基线监控:通过统计模型建立智能体正常行为轮廓,异常操作触发实时告警
- 沙箱逃逸检测:基于seccomp-bpf限制系统调用权限,阻断潜在提权攻击
- 密钥轮换自动化:集成硬件安全模块(HSM),支持每24小时自动轮换加密密钥
四、企业级落地实践指南
1. 典型应用场景
- 财务对账机器人:连接ERP、银行API和税务系统,自动完成日均万级交易核对
- 智能客服坐席:通过NLP引擎理解用户意图,动态调用知识库和工单系统
- 工业质检系统:协调视觉检测设备与MES系统,实现缺陷自动分类与处置
2. 性能优化建议
- 资源配额管理:为不同优先级智能体设置CPU/内存硬限制,避免资源争抢
- 批处理优化:对高吞吐场景启用任务合并机制,减少上下文切换开销
- 模型热更新:通过Sidecar模式实现AI模型无缝升级,服务中断时间<500ms
3. 监控告警体系
建议构建包含以下维度的观测系统:
┌───────────────┬───────────────┬───────────────┐│ 指标类别 │ 关键指标 │ 告警阈值 │├───────────────┼───────────────┼───────────────┤│ 性能指标 │ 任务延迟(P99) │ >500ms ││ │ 资源利用率 │ 持续>85% │├───────────────┼───────────────┼───────────────┤│ 安全指标 │ 策略违规次数 │ >3次/分钟 ││ │ 敏感数据泄露 │ 检测到即告警 │├───────────────┼───────────────┼───────────────┤│ 可靠性指标 │ 实例存活率 │ <99.9% ││ │ 重启次数 │ >2次/小时 │└───────────────┴───────────────┴───────────────┘
五、生态扩展与未来演进
平台预留了丰富的扩展接口,支持企业通过插件机制集成:
- 自定义数据源连接器(如专有数据库驱动)
- 领域特定策略评估器(如金融合规检查规则)
- 异构计算设备加速库(如量子计算模拟器)
据开发团队透露,2026年第四季度将推出以下新特性:
- 联邦学习支持:实现跨组织智能体协同训练
- 形式化验证工具链:自动生成安全策略证明
- 边缘-云端协同:优化低带宽场景下的模型同步机制
作为企业级AI智能体领域的里程碑式产品,NemoClaw通过将复杂技术封装为标准化组件,显著降低了自主智能体的开发门槛。其安全设计理念与跨平台特性,尤为适合金融、医疗、制造等强监管行业的数字化转型需求。随着生态系统的持续完善,该平台有望成为新一代智能业务自动化的基础设施标准。

发表评论
登录后可评论,请前往 登录 或 注册